Super 8 By Wyndham Nashville Downtown
36.2083296554474, -86.7783746123314Situated approximately a 10-minute ride from Top Golf, the lovely Super 8 By Wyndham Nashville Downtown hotel offers a business centre with a range of business amenities. The 2-star hotel entices guests with parking, available on site.
Location
Located within a 6-km distance of The George Jones, this Nashville property is also within 25 minutes' walk of Lock One Park. The nearby sports attractions are Bridgestone Arena (6 km), and Nissan Multi-Purpose Stadium (4.8 km). The area offers shopping experiences such as Farmer's Market, which is nearly a 10-minute ride from the hotel.
For those travelling from afar, Nashville International airport is 15 minutes' drive away.
Rooms
The rooms provide ironing facilities and air conditioning, along with tea and coffee making facilities for guests' comfort. They have a welcoming interior. Bathrooms include a bathtub and a separate toilet, along with comforts such as hairdryers and bath sheets.
Eat & Drink
Jack in the Box is only a few steps from this non-smoking hotel.
Leisure & Business
Among other amenities, the Super 8 By Wyndham Nashville Downtown offers a swimming pool.
